From 36496b16115bdfb6d47bf74057a726c355359fc5 Mon Sep 17 00:00:00 2001 From: saatchi-david Date: Fri, 22 Nov 2024 04:28:54 +0900 Subject: [PATCH] Added new gpt4o model and set "gpt 4o (latest)" as default model for ChatOpenAI node. (#3543) * Chore/Add gpt-4o-2024-11-20 * add the latest gpt4o model. * Update models.json - fix linting * Update models.json - fix linting issue 2 * Updated default model in ChatOpenAI node from gpt 3.5 turbo gpt4o * Update ChatOpenAI.ts --------- Co-authored-by: Henry Heng --- packages/components/models.json | 4 ++++ packages/components/nodes/chatmodels/ChatOpenAI/ChatOpenAI.ts | 2 +- 2 files changed, 5 insertions(+), 1 deletion(-) diff --git a/packages/components/models.json b/packages/components/models.json index b8dd649f9..36ae52500 100644 --- a/packages/components/models.json +++ b/packages/components/models.json @@ -592,6 +592,10 @@ "label": "gpt-4o (latest)", "name": "gpt-4o" }, + { + "label": "gpt-4o-2024-11-20", + "name": "gpt-4o-2024-11-20" + }, { "label": "gpt-4o-2024-08-06", "name": "gpt-4o-2024-08-06" diff --git a/packages/components/nodes/chatmodels/ChatOpenAI/ChatOpenAI.ts b/packages/components/nodes/chatmodels/ChatOpenAI/ChatOpenAI.ts index e12524ad0..c3ba61cc0 100644 --- a/packages/components/nodes/chatmodels/ChatOpenAI/ChatOpenAI.ts +++ b/packages/components/nodes/chatmodels/ChatOpenAI/ChatOpenAI.ts @@ -47,7 +47,7 @@ class ChatOpenAI_ChatModels implements INode { name: 'modelName', type: 'asyncOptions', loadMethod: 'listModels', - default: 'gpt-3.5-turbo' + default: 'gpt-4o-mini' }, { label: 'Temperature',